Output 369fb381c234de79395ec64a305d13d0f7334856ac7c0a44199dc40cde57ac21:2

value
23845695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ab5476d7e1113ce2aa4675d49589e86a02a0f3 OP_EQUAL
address
MQTjnN5nkVYKdkY12g3yzMz2TK8GiuUu2P
transaction
369fb381c234de79395ec64a305d13d0f7334856ac7c0a44199dc40cde57ac21
spent
true